How they compare

Dominican Republic currently reports 31.69 billion current US$ against 27.04 billion current US$ in Croatia, a difference of 4.65 billion current US$.

That makes Dominican Republic's figure about 1.2 times Croatia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Croatia ahead.

Globally, Croatia ranks 63rd and Dominican Republic ranks 60th of 180 countries.

Gross fixed capital formation includes acquisitions less disposals of fixed assets during the accounting period, including certain specified expenditures on services that add to the value of non-produced assets.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
